FAQs for Family Medicine Expert Witnesses
What is the role of a Family Medicine expert witness in legal cases?
A Family Medicine expert witness provides insight on standard care practices, diagnoses, treatments, and other medical issues within the scope of family medicine.
What types of cases can a Family Medicine expert witness contribute to?
They can contribute to cases involving misdiagnosis, improper treatment, preventive care issues, medication errors, and more within the context of primary care.
Are there subspecialties within Family Medicine that an expert witness might focus on?
Yes, subspecialties include geriatric medicine, sports medicine, adolescent medicine, sleep medicine, and palliative care among others.
How can a Family Medicine expert witness help in malpractice lawsuits?
They can review patient records, testify on accepted standards of care, evaluate physician performance and provide an informed opinion on whether malpractice occurred.
Why is it important to have a Family Medicine expert witness who is board-certified?
Board certification ensures the expert has met rigorous standards in their field. It adds credibility to their testimony and demonstrates their expertise.
